The city of stardust and a zillion dreams, the magic associated with Mumbai in the sub-continent is phenomenal. The array of flavors that the city of Mumbai exhibits is pregnant with history and has a story associated with it. A conglomeration of seven islands, the sprawling metropolis of Bombay was renamed Mumbai in the honor of the local deity Mumba Devi. The city witnesses a large number of people flocking to it on a regular basis to explore varied opportunities. Mumbai has a lot to offer to everyone. It can boast of resplendent colonial relics, a delectable gastronomic culture, pulsating nightlife and sprawling markets offering amazing bargains.

Mumbai City- The Modern Paradise in India

The commercial capital of India, our very own Mumbai can also be referred to as the tourism capital of our country. This is in keeping with the boom in tourism in Mumbai over the last two decades. Mumbai is the hub of Bollywood paraphernalia, numerous shopping malls, the double-decker BEST buses, awesome nightlife and not to forget the Mumbai monsoon. My cousin brother recently got himself settled in Mumbai and had been inviting me for a Mumbai tour ever since. Therefore, on his repeated insistence, I landed in this amazing city to experience a tinge of the so-called Mumbai life. As soon as I landed, there was a hoard of yellow-black taxis waiting with ‘taxiwallahs’ coaxing me to hire one.

Finally, my Mumbai expedition started at the Gateway of India. Situated in the Colaba area and flanked by the Arabian Sea and Mumbai Harbour, it was a feast for my awe-stricken eyes. I visited a long list of tourist spots during my Mumbai darshan. It included Juhu Beach, Linking Road, Prince Wales Museum, Siddhivinayak Temple, Haji Ali and the magnificent Bandra-Worli sea link. I also took a ride on the ‘lifeline’ of this city- the Mumbai local trains.
